From Daily Radar (http://www.dailyradar.com/news/game_news_6463.html)
And we thought cell phones caused a lot of accidents. A new hazard awaits technology\'s early adopters: How about a Ford Lincoln Navigator equipped with a PlayStation2? That\'s just one of the in-vehicle goodies that will be on display at at the annual Consumer Electronics Show Jan. 6-9.
A pair of new Navigators demonstrating networked consumer electronics and computer products linked over the new automotive-grade IDB-1394 multimedia standard will be on show in the 1394 Trade Association exhibit. Besides the PS2, the Navigator also features an interchangeable CD player, camcorder and DVD. A customer convenience port built into the network backbone lets users plug in electronic devices, such as a notebook computer or handheld device, using the same cable that is used in the home.
Down the corridor in 10169, the IDB Forum\'s exhibit, will be Mack\'s Vision model truck, with an 18-inch flat panel and touch panel displays from Planar Systems, DVD system and CD changer from Panasonic, Fujitsu CD/MD audio system, Motorola iDEN telephone, Rand McNally Palm V, Sony camcorder, VST hard disk drive and other systems running on plastic optical fiber from Sumitomo under an interface module, called DHIVA, developed by Digital Harmony Technologies. DHIVA also is in use in the Navigator.
"These in-vehicle multimedia exhibits demonstrate the potential of the IDB-1394 specification to provide complete, easy-to-use, multimedia connectivity in cars, trucks, SUVs, and other vehicles," said IDB Forum Executive Director Arlan Stehney. "IDB-1394 is the most efficient, powerful standard for these exciting applications, and we\'re pleased to be able to show both the Mack Truck and the Lincoln Navigator at CES."

I just wish to point out here that SUVs ARE involved in more accidents in the US than any other vehicle type.
Partly this has to do with the sheer number of SUVs. But it also has to do with SUVs having a higher center of gravity (because of the raised suspensions) that make them much more prone to \'roll-over\' type accidents, as witnessed by the infamous Suzuki \'Sidekick\' and the many accidents involving the Ford Explorer (almost a third of all Explorer accidents involved a \'roll-over\').
A high center of gravity is needed to negotiate difficult terrain. However, it is detrimental to regular road-traveling vehicles, especially high-speed long distance traveling. All the best cars are low-slung to lower the center of gravity so they aren\'t \'tipped-over\' on curves and high speed turns, and are much more stable in emergency braking situations.
In case you didn\'t know BTW, the insurance rates for SUVs are also much higher than the rates for simular types of cars.
